2 Uniswap (UNI)
As a leading decentralized exchange (DEX) token, UNI's appeal for smart money in Q1 2027 lies in its governance power over the Uniswap protocol, which continues to dominate DEX volume. The ongoing debate and potential implementation of a fee switch, which would direct protocol fees to token holders, could be a significant catalyst. However, competition from other DEXs and the evolving regulatory stance on DeFi present considerable risks that investors will monitor.

5 dYdX (DYDX)
DYDX's transition to its own Cosmos-based chain positions it as a leader in decentralized perpetuals trading. For Q1 2027, smart money will assess its ability to maintain high liquidity and capture a significant share of the derivatives market. Its focus on decentralization and performance could attract users wary of centralized exchange risks, but the competitive landscape and technical execution risks are factors to consider.

What is the significance of 'quantum resistance' for crypto assets?
Quantum resistance refers to cryptographic methods designed to withstand attacks from future quantum computers. As quantum computing advances, current encryption standards could become vulnerable. Assets incorporating quantum-resistant designs offer enhanced long-term security, protecting against potential breaches down the line.

What are the primary risks associated with exchange tokens?
Primary risks include regulatory crackdowns, declining trading volumes impacting revenue, security breaches or hacks, intense competition from new platforms, and the general volatility inherent in the cryptocurrency market. Investors should conduct thorough due diligence and consider their risk tolerance.
